Understanding the Exhaust System
Before diving into specific exhaust parts, it is vital to understand the parts that comprise a normal exhaust system in a Dodge Ram 3500 Parts Ram. The exhaust system is generally consisted of the following parts:
ComponentFunctionTire ManifoldCollects exhaust gases from the engine's cylinders.Catalytic ConverterTransforms hazardous gases into less hazardous emissions.Exhaust PipeBrings exhaust gases from the engine to the muffler.MufflerDecreases sound produced by the exhaust gases.TailpipeLast outlet for the exhaust gases to exit the car.ResonatorTones the exhaust sound and additional minimizes noise.Significance of Each Exhaust Component
Exhaust Manifold: This is the very first element that exhaust gases come across as they exit the engine. An efficiency exhaust manifold can enhance airflow, allowing for much better engine performance and power.

Catalytic Converter: Essential for meeting emissions regulations, a high-performance catalytic converter can enhance exhaust circulation while still lowering damaging emissions.

Exhaust Pipe: The diameter and material of the exhaust pipe significantly affect the general system efficiency. Larger, mandrel-bent pipes can improve airflow, causing enhanced horse power and torque.

Muffler: This component directly affects the sound of the car. Performance mufflers can provide the truck a throatier noise while minimizing back pressure.

Tailpipe: The tailpipe completes the exhaust system and can affect noise and look. Numerous styles, such as double or single suggestions, can enhance looks.

Resonator: This optional part even more alters the sound of the exhaust system, permitting a deeper tone or lowering drone at certain RPMs.

When picking exhaust parts for a Dodge Ram Maintenance Parts Ram, numerous factors should be thought about:
Fitment: Ensure parts work with the specific design year and engine type of your Ram.Material: Choose premium products like stainless-steel for toughness and resistance to rust.Sound Preference: Determine the desired noise level and tone, which can vary considerably between various mufflers and resonators.Performance Goals: Identify whether the goal is purely sound enhancement or if performance improvements are needed too.Setup of Exhaust Parts
